solver indications depend on place of cursor: I usually play "hard" games. I have "track additions" enabled in order to see a "clear board" (without the grey square around a clicked square). When the game has a "Calculated difficulty" more then 64-65 different difficulties and "Amount of trial-and-error required to solve:" are shown depending on where the cursor is. When I click on "untracked" to the right calculated difficulty is 70 and "Amount of trial-and-error required to solve:" are 3 If I click on the upper left square calculated difficulty is 66 and "Amount of trial-and-error required to solve:" are 2
